- Abstract
In order to meet the requirement of space payload system and the data transmission, a scheme of periodical and concurrent dynamic bandwidth allocation (DBA) of switching FC-AE-1553 network was proposed based on both theoretical analysis and simulation approaches. Compared with traditional solutions, the network throughput was increased by 10 times, and the time delay was decreased by one order of magnitude.
